Questions & Answers
Q: What books are included in Starla's March TBR list?
Starla's March TBR list features books like "Honey Girl," "Yesterday is History," "Can't Take That Away," "Persephone Station," "Jade War," "A Court of Silver Flames," and "Vagabonds."
Q: How does Starla plan to participate in Tome Topple readathon?
Starla mentions her excitement for the Tome Topple readathon, where she plans to read books over 500 pages, with specific prompts to follow for different categories.
Q: Why is Starla intrigued by the book "Vagabonds" by Hao Jingfang?
Starla is excited about "Vagabonds" due to its science fiction elements, political intrigue, author's background in physics and economics, and comparisons to the "Three-Body Problem" trilogy.
Q: What events is Starla participating in March related to books?
Starla mentions hosting a Patreon group read, moderating an event with Kosoko Jackson for "Yesterday is History," and reading with Jessie from Envy Book Club for "Can't Take That Away."
